当前位置:首页 / EXCEL

Excel非空白函数怎么用?如何正确表示?

作者:佚名|分类:EXCEL|浏览:65|发布时间:2025-03-12 11:45:12

Excel非空白函数的使用与正确表示

在Excel中,非空白函数是一个非常实用的工具,它可以帮助用户快速识别和筛选出非空单元格的数据。通过使用这些函数,可以提高工作效率,减少手动检查的时间。本文将详细介绍Excel中非空白函数的使用方法以及如何正确表示这些函数。

一、非空白函数概述

非空白函数是Excel中用于检测单元格是否为空的一类函数。常见的非空白函数包括`ISBLANK()`、`COUNTA()`、`COUNTIF()`等。这些函数可以帮助用户在处理大量数据时,快速定位到非空单元格,从而进行后续的数据处理和分析。

二、ISBLANK()函数

`ISBLANK()`函数是检测单元格是否为空的函数。其语法如下:

```excel

ISBLANK(cell)

```

其中,`cell`表示需要检测的单元格或单元格区域。

如果单元格为空,则返回`TRUE`。

如果单元格不为空,则返回`FALSE`。

例如,要检测A1单元格是否为空,可以使用以下公式:

```excel

=ISBLANK(A1)

```

如果A1单元格为空,则公式返回`TRUE`;如果A1单元格不为空,则公式返回`FALSE`。

三、COUNTA()函数

`COUNTA()`函数用于计算区域中非空单元格的个数。其语法如下:

```excel

COUNTA(value1, [value2], ...)

```

其中,`value1, value2, ...`表示需要计算非空单元格个数的单元格或单元格区域。

例如,要计算A1到A10区域中非空单元格的个数,可以使用以下公式:

```excel

=COUNTA(A1:A10)

```

该公式将返回A1到A10区域中非空单元格的个数。

四、COUNTIF()函数

`COUNTIF()`函数用于计算区域中满足特定条件的单元格个数。其语法如下:

```excel

COUNTIF(range, criteria)

```

其中,`range`表示需要计算满足条件的单元格个数的区域,`criteria`表示条件表达式。

例如,要计算A1到A10区域中大于10的单元格个数,可以使用以下公式:

```excel

=COUNTIF(A1:A10, ">10")

```

该公式将返回A1到A10区域中大于10的单元格个数。

五、如何正确表示非空白函数

在使用非空白函数时,需要注意以下几点,以确保正确表示:

1. 函数名称应使用正确的拼写,如`ISBLANK()`、`COUNTA()`、`COUNTIF()`等。

2. 函数参数应按照正确的顺序和格式提供,如`ISBLANK(A1)`、`COUNTA(A1:A10)`、`COUNTIF(A1:A10, ">10")`等。

3. 条件表达式应使用正确的运算符和格式,如`>`、`<`、`=`等。

4. 避免在函数中使用错误的单元格引用或区域引用。

六、相关问答

1. 如何在Excel中快速检测一列中的空白单元格?

答:可以使用`ISBLANK()`函数结合`IF()`函数来实现。例如,要检测A列中的空白单元格,可以使用以下公式:

```excel

=IF(ISBLANK(A1), "空白", "非空白")

```

然后,将公式向下拖动到A列的末尾,即可快速检测一列中的空白单元格。

2. COUNTA()函数和COUNT()函数有什么区别?

答:`COUNTA()`函数用于计算区域中非空单元格的个数,而`COUNT()`函数用于计算区域中数值型单元格的个数。如果区域中包含文本、逻辑值或错误值,`COUNTA()`函数会将其计算在内,而`COUNT()`函数则不会。

3. 如何在Excel中使用COUNTIF()函数排除特定值?

答:可以在`COUNTIF()`函数的条件表达式中使用否定运算符`~`来排除特定值。例如,要计算A1到A10区域中不等于“苹果”的单元格个数,可以使用以下公式:

```excel

=COUNTIF(A1:A10, "~苹果")

```

这样,公式将返回A1到A10区域中不等于“苹果”的单元格个数。

通过以上内容,相信大家对Excel中的非空白函数有了更深入的了解。在实际应用中,灵活运用这些函数,可以大大提高数据处理和分析的效率。